Driving

Ignition lock

Insert the remote control all the way into the
ignition lock.

>

Radio readiness switches on.
Individual electrical consumers can operate.

>

The electric steering wheel lock disen-
gages audibly.

Insert the remote control into the ignition
lock before you move the vehicle, other-

wise the electric steering wheel lock will not dis-
engage and you will not be able to steer the
car.

<

Removing the remote control from the
ignition lock

Press the remote control in briefly; it is ejected
part of the way.
At the same time:

>

The ignition switches off if it was on before-
hand.

>

The electric steering wheel lock engages
audibly.

Automatic transmission

You cannot take out the remote control unless
the selector lever is in the P position: interlock.

Start/stop button

Each time the start/stop button is pressed,
radio readiness or the ignition is switched on or
off.

Briefly pressing the start/stop button
while the brake or clutch is depressed

starts the engine.

<

Radio readiness

Individual electrical consumers can operate.
The time and the outside temperature are dis-
played in the instrument cluster.
Radio readiness is switched off automatically:

>

Immediately when the remote control is
removed from the ignition lock

>

Ignition on

Most of the indicator and warning lamps in the
indicator area

1 of the instrument cluster, refer

to page

13

, light up and remain on for different

lengths of time.

Radio readiness and ignition off

All indicator and warning lamps in the instru-
ment cluster go out.
